Package: libpoppler-glib3
Version: 0.8.7-1
Severity: normal
Hi,
a user on #debian-security ("schmidt") reported that the pdf
linked from this page
http://de.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bild:WikiReader_Digest_2005-17.pdf
uses all memory when nautilus tries to create the thumbnail via
evince-thumbnailer (which in turn uses poppler).
I killed evince when it grew over 2GB mem usage. Acroread and
gv can display the file with about 100-150MB mem usage.
